eth switch mirror egress
Enable or disable the specified port to be the Mirror Egress Port.
SYNTAX:
where:
EXAMPLE:
Here port 1 is enabled as Mirror Egress Port
Here port 1 is disabled as Mirror Egress Port
RELATED COMMANDS:
Only one port can be the Mirror Egress Port at any one time.
But a port can be the Mirror Egress Port and the Mirror Ingress Port at the same time.
eth switch mirror egress
port = <number{1-4}>
[state = <{enabled | disabled}>]
port
The port to be the Mirror Egress Port.
Note
If no port number is specified, then the port number of the current Mirror
Egress Port is shown.
REQUIRED
state
Enable or disable the port as Mirror Egress Port.
The default is
enabled
.
OPTIONAL
=>eth switch mirror egress port=1
=>eth switch mirror egress
Egress mirror port = 1
=>
=>eth switch mirror egress
Egress mirror port = 1
=>eth switch mirror egress port=1 state=disabled
=>eth switch mirror egress
=>
